当前位置: 首页 > 产品大全 > 图解区块链技术及其应用 从底层原理到软硬件生态

图解区块链技术及其应用 从底层原理到软硬件生态

图解区块链技术及其应用 从底层原理到软硬件生态

引言:不只是数字货币

提到区块链,很多人首先想到的是比特币等加密货币。区块链的本质是一个去中心化、不可篡改的分布式账本技术,其应用早已超越金融领域,正深刻影响着计算机软硬件及辅助设备的生态。本文将通过图解与解析,为您清晰地展现区块链的技术原理及其在计算机产业中的多元化应用。

第一部分:区块链技术核心原理图解

要理解应用,首先要明白其底层机制。我们可以将区块链想象成一个由“区块”串联而成的“链条”。

1. 区块结构:
每个区块就像一个数据包,主要包含三部分:

  • 区块头(Header): 包含时间戳、上一个区块的哈希值(如同独一无二的数字指纹)、本区块的哈希值以及一个称为“随机数”的谜题答案。
  • 交易数据(Data): 记录该时间段内所有有效的交易或信息。
  • 哈希值(Hash): 由区块内所有数据通过密码学哈希函数(如SHA-256)计算得出的固定长度字符串,是数据的唯一标识。任何数据变动都会导致哈希值剧变。

2. 链式连接:
每个新区块的“区块头”中都包含了前一个区块的哈希值。这就形成了环环相扣的链条。如果有人想篡改历史中的任何一个区块,该区块的哈希值就会改变,导致后续所有区块的哈希值失效,从而会被整个网络轻易识别和拒绝。这种设计保证了数据的不可篡改性

3. 分布式存储与共识机制:
区块链网络中没有中心服务器。数据被复制并存储在网络中的所有参与节点(即计算机)上。当新交易产生时,节点们通过一套规则(共识机制,如工作量证明PoW、权益证明PoS)来竞争记账权并达成一致,确保所有节点上的账本副本同步且一致。这实现了去中心化高容错性

第二部分:区块链在计算机软硬件及辅助设备中的应用

区块链的特性为计算机产业带来了新的信任模式和价值流转方式。

应用一:硬件身份认证与供应链溯源
问题: 假冒伪劣的CPU、显卡、硬盘、服务器组件充斥市场,消费者和企業难以验证其真伪和来源。
区块链解决方案: 芯片制造商可以为每一颗关键芯片(如CPU)在生产时生成一个唯一的、基于区块链的数字身份。此后,从出厂、分销、组装到最终用户手中的每一个流转环节,其状态(如地理位置、所有者变更、维修记录)都以不可篡改的方式记录在链上。
* 图解场景: 用户购买了一台高端显卡,扫描二维码即可查看其在区块链上的“一生履历”,确认其为原厂正品、非矿卡,且享有完整的保修服务。这极大地增强了硬件产品的可信度

应用二:软件分发与版权保护
问题: 软件盗版、许可证滥用、更新包被恶意篡改。
区块链解决方案:
* 正版验证: 软件许可证或激活密钥可以以通证(Token)的形式在区块链上发行和流转。每次验证都在链上进行,杜绝复制和伪造。

  • 安全更新: 软件开发商发布的更新包可以生成哈希值并记录在链上。用户下载更新时,可对比哈希值,确保文件完整且未被中间人攻击篡改。
  • 开源代码协作: 使用区块链记录代码的每一次提交、合并和贡献者信息,形成透明、不可抵赖的贡献记录。

应用三:构建去中心化的计算与存储网络
问题: 中心化的云服务存在单点故障风险、数据隐私泄露风险,且资源利用可能不充分。
区块链解决方案(如Filecoin, IPFS与区块链结合):
* 分布式存储: 鼓励用户将闲置的硬盘空间贡献出来,形成一个全球化的存储市场。存储提供者需要抵押通证作为保证金,而存储证明(如数据仍然完整存在)被记录在区块链上,确保服务的可靠性。用户支付通证来购买存储服务。

  • 分布式计算: 类似地,可以组织全球闲置的算力(CPU/GPU),用于渲染、科学计算、AI训练等任务。区块链智能合约自动匹配任务与算力,并结算报酬。这对于需要海量算力但预算有限的项目(如学术研究)极具价值。

应用四:物联网设备的安全协同与数据货币化
问题: 物联网设备(如摄像头、传感器、智能家居)数量庞大,中心化管理成本高,设备间缺乏可信的自动化协作,产生的海量数据价值未被有效挖掘。
区块链解决方案:
* 安全身份与通信: 每个物联网设备拥有一个区块链身份,设备间的指令传输和状态同步可通过智能合约自动、可信地执行,无需经过不可信的中心服务器。

  • 数据确权与交易: 设备产生的数据(如交通流量、环境监测数据)的所有权和使用权可以通过区块链进行确权。数据所有者可以安全地将数据在市场上出售给研究机构或企业,并通过微支付系统获得收益,从而形成“数据即资产”的新模式。

第三部分:对计算机产业的挑战与展望

区块链的应用也带来了新的挑战:

  • 硬件需求: 某些共识机制(如PoW)耗能巨大,催生了专用矿机(ASIC)产业,但也引发了能效争议。新的共识机制(如PoS)和硬件加速方案正在探索中。
  • 软件生态: 需要开发新的开发工具、中间件和标准协议,以降低区块链应用(DApp)的开发门槛。
  • 性能瓶颈: 传统区块链的吞吐量和交易确认速度仍不及中心化系统,这推动着分片、二层网络等扩容技术的研究,也对网络设备和计算性能提出了更高要求。

展望未来,区块链技术与计算机软硬件的结合将更加紧密。我们可能会看到:
1. “区块链就绪”硬件: 出厂即集成安全加密芯片和区块链身份模块的计算机设备。
2. 可信计算环境普及: 基于区块链的可信执行环境(TEE)成为高端服务器和硬件的标配,保障关键计算和数据交换的绝对安全。
3. 去中心化应用生态繁荣: 在存储、计算、网络带宽等领域,形成稳定、可用的去中心化替代方案,与中心化云服务互补共存。

###

区块链远非一项孤立的技术,它正作为一种新型的“信任基础设施”,与计算机软硬件深度集成,从底层重塑数据的确权、存储、交换与价值流转方式。从确保一颗芯片的真实性,到调度全球的闲置算力,区块链的应用图谱正在快速扩展。理解其原理并关注其在计算机产业中的落地,对于开发者、企业和消费者都至关重要。

更新时间:2026-02-11 18:43:49

如若转载,请注明出处:http://www.hioplus.com/product/12.html